| Subject category | Comment text |
|---|---|
| Deposit | QUARTZ VEIN IN ANDESITE NEAR CONTACT WITH QUARTZ MONZONITE. THE VEIN MATERIAL IS COMPOSED OF CLAY, ANGULAR FRAGMENTS OF DK GREY ANDESITE AND PARTICLES OF CRUSHED QUARTZ. |
